Model Call Girl in Tilak Nagar Delhi reach out to us at 🔝9953056974🔝
An ATM with an Eye.pptx
1. AN ATM WITH AN EYE
SRI VENKATESWARA INSTITUTE OF
TECHNOLOGY
DEPARTMENT OF COMPUTER SCIENCE &
ENGINEERING
Under the Guidance of
Mr.S.M.P.Qubeb M.tech,(PhD)
Assistant Professor
2. CONTENTS
Problem statement
Proposed system
Tools used in MAD
1. Cloud firestore
2. Firebase authentication
3. Google places API
4. Recycle View
5. Android architecture components
6. Upload API
Advantages
3. PROBLEM STATEMENT
In the present world, transportation has major importance,
So services related to transportation also have the same
level of importance while traveling to unknown places it is
becoming very difficult in finding the mechanic to solve the
problems related to the vehicles.
In this application, the user can get all the related details
about the mechanic. So by that information, the user can
communicate with the mechanic so quickly near to the user.
In this application we are providing two options for the user
to search for a mechanic that is a) Type of mechanic b)
Location
4. Proposed System:
With the proposed system we are going to solve
the existing problems By developing an
application.
All the mechanics have to register with this
application. After registering with this application
all the data related to the mechanics will be stored
in the database.
By using this application customer can find the
list of mechanics by specifying the following
options. 1) Type of vehicle. 2) Location.
5. Cloud Firestore
Cloud Firestore is a flexible, scalable database for
mobile, web, and server development from Firebase
and Google Cloud Platform
scalable NoSQL cloud database to store and sync
data for client- and server-side development.
Key capabilities :
Flexibility
Expressive querying
Offline support
Realtime updates
6. Firebase Authentication:
You can use Firebase Authentication to
sign in a user by sending an SMS message
to the user's phone. The user signs in using
a one-time code contained in the SMS
message.
8. Google places API:
The Places API lets you search for
place information.
A Find Place request takes a text input
and returns a place.
The input can be any kind of Places
text data, such as a name, address, or
phone number
10. Recycler View:
If your app needs to display a scrolling list of
elements based on large data sets you should
use RecyclerView
The RecycleView widget is a more advanced and
flexible version of ListView.
11. Android Architecture
Components
Android architecture components are a collection of
libraries that help you to design robust,testable and
maintainable apps
That contains Lifecycle-aware components. It can
solve problems with configuration changes, supports
data persistence
12. Upload API:
provides direct file upload service
You can upload any binary data (including
images, videos and text files)
13. ADVANTAGES
Time saving
Ease of searching the mechanic
Availability of variety of mechanics
Helpful for everyone